Release checklist — Rooksbane gateway. Flaky DNS resolution in the resolver pool is mitigated, not fixed: we pinned the retry budget to 3 and added jittered backoff. Confirm the synthetic lookup canary stays green for 24h before ship. Future maintainers: do not raise the cache TTL past 60s without re-running the soak test. The soak was last validated against the build below.

pipeline stamp: htk21_4adfc7a400dc735eb9849

**Ticket: Config drift on retry idempotency keys**

Prod and staging have diverged on the LedgerLoop retry service. Staging generates idempotency keys per attempt; prod generates per payment intent, which is correct. Somebody hand-edited staging in March and never committed it. Result: duplicate charge alerts firing in staging tests. Don't copy staging values anywhere. Fix: align staging to the canonical prod config and commit it. The canonical values follow.

deployment values, kajep-kageg:
[praix]
host = praix.paliqcorp.corp
user = praix_svc
database = praix_prod

Hey — before you can review my branch, heads up: the Brimworth secrets vault that holds the QueueLift scaling tokens locked itself again after the cert rotation. The autoscaler reads queue-depth metrics from Pondermill, and without the vault open, the integration tests just hang, so don't blame your review env. I already pinged the platform folks; they said any reviewer can unseal it themselves. Pop open the vault CLI, pick the QueueLift realm, and paste in the recovery passphrase below.

vault phrase of tagaf-hawef = jordor-wenok-gorael-wenion-keleth-sorion-wenys-novix-fenir-fraax-fenael-aldius-fraok

TICKET RT-209: Timing-chip reader rejecting plugin bundle

Gatepost Mk3 readers at the Kelstone Marathon fail signature verification on third-party split-time plugins built after v2.4. Cause: we rotated certs; older SDK embeds the retired one. Plugin authors: rebuild against SDK 2.4.1 and re-sign. Verification uses the new chain only. Current deploy key follows.

deploy key for kajof-fajop: bky6_gDHw9Q